Tether's Bitcoin Mining Operation in Uruguay Halted Due to Power Contract Dispute

By: www.tokenpost.kr|2026/08/27 14:00:33

Tether's Bitcoin mining operation in Uruguay has been halted due to a dispute over the power supply contract and unpaid electricity bills. The investment scale for the two mining sites is estimated at $120 million, and the local company Microfin has laid off 30 of its 38 employees. According to internal documents from Uruguay's state power company UTE, Tether's mining plans have effectively collapsed. Tether is estimated to have invested about $60 million in each of the two mining sites. The crux of the dispute lies in the interpretation of the power supply quantity; Tether viewed it as a minimum supply requirement, while UTE considered it a ceiling that could not be exceeded. Microfin stopped paying electricity bills in May 2025 and informed UTE of its intention to terminate the contract in June. UTE attempted to maintain the operation with a revised contract, but Tether's representatives did not participate in the signing process. UTE ceased power supply to the mining site on July 25, 2025. The unpaid electricity bills amount to approximately $5 million, with monthly electricity costs reported to be around $2 million. Tether notified of the operational halt and layoff plans on November 25, 2025. The Uruguayan electricity union AUTE stated that Microfin entered into a five-year contract in 2023 but stopped paying electricity bills due to unprofitability. Bitcoin mining is heavily reliant on electricity costs, and fluctuations in power prices and supply stability can pressure profitability.
